Madrasas
E1159160
UNEXPLORED
Madrasas are Islamic educational institutions that traditionally provide religious instruction alongside basic secular studies within Muslim communities.

Madrasa Rahimiyya
Madrasa Rahimiyya was a prominent Islamic seminary in Delhi that became an influential center of religious scholarship and reform in early modern South Asia.

Saffarin Madrasa
Saffarin Madrasa is a historic Islamic educational institution in Fez, Morocco, renowned as one of the city’s oldest madrasas and an important example of Marinid-era architecture.

Mustansiriya Madrasah
Mustansiriya Madrasah is a historic medieval Islamic college in Baghdad, renowned as one of the oldest universities in the world and a major center of learning during the Abbasid era.

Al-Attarine Madrasa
Al-Attarine Madrasa is a historic 14th-century Islamic college in Fez, Morocco, renowned for its exquisite Marinid architecture and intricate decorative artistry.

Barelvi madrasas
Barelvi madrasas are traditional Sunni Islamic seminaries in South Asia associated with the Barelvi movement, emphasizing devotional practices, Sufi-oriented theology, and the veneration of the Prophet Muhammad.
